Avery Point by Erickson Senior Living is Hiring a Security Officer Near Richmond, VA

Location:

Avery Point by Erickson Senior Living

Avery Point is a beautiful 94-acre continuing care retirement community located just 15 minutes from downtown Richmond in Short Pump, Virginia. We’re part of a growing network of communities developed and managed by Erickson Senior Living, a national provider of senior living and health care with campuses in 11 states—and growing.

We are hiring a Security and Emergency Services (SES) Utility Officer I who; is responsible for carrying out the SES Program under the direction of the Supervisor. This position performs regular patrols of the property, provides relief staffing for the gatehouse and responds to non-emergency calls for service. This position may also function in a support role on emergency responses under the direct supervision of an EMR Officer/Supervisor.

Compensation: $17.00 Per Hour

How you will make an impact:

  • Routine interior and exterior patrols of the buildings and grounds
  • Conducts safety checks and inspections in support of Life Safety and OSHA compliance
  • Receives calls for non-emergency service from dispatch and security by radio or telephone and responds timely and appropriately.
  • Responds and assists in Community Emergencies, including but not limited to; fires, floods, severe weather, hazardous materials incidents, bomb threats, and evacuations.
  • Responds and assists with searches of missing residents.
  • Maintains a visible and professional presence at the gatehouse
  • Creates the best initial impression of the community
  • Acknowledges visitors provide a pleasant greeting and offer assistance as needed to all persons entering the community.
  • Screens all vehicle and pedestrian traffic entering the community per the gatehouse SOP
  • Provides proper parking passes, maps, and instructs visitors to park in appropriate spaces.
  • Documents all visitors and vendors/contractors via the standard Gatehouse log in legible handwriting.

What you will need:

  • Ability to work independently and as a contributing team member
  • Ability to demonstrate professional and responsive interactions with residents and their family members, staff, vendors, and each other
  • Ability to document daily activities in a clear and concise manner
  • Ability to safely operate Security vehicles
  • Ability to work with computer systems
  • 18 years of age or older
  • Possess and maintain a valid driver’s license

*All required licenses and certifications must be maintained as a condition of employment*
